Permalink
Commits on Apr 7, 2011
Commits on Mar 25, 2011
  1. Rekey POE::Resource::FileHandles on file descriptor instead of handle.

    rcaputo committed Mar 25, 2011
    iThreads changed filehandle stringification.  This change works around
    the issue, making POE that much more iThread-safe (and therefore
    fork-tender on Windows).  Thanks, Plixer International for sponsoring
    this and the several recent iThreads/Windows related changes.
  2. Clear out the event queue by session ID rather than reference.

    rcaputo committed Mar 25, 2011
    I suspect this was causing defunct parent-process events to linger in
    the child-process queue after POE::Kernel->stop() was called.  Their
    dispatch in the child process may have caused the "hilarity" I have
    seen in the wild.
Commits on Mar 9, 2011
Commits on Feb 21, 2011
  1. add tracing regression test

    apocalypse committed with rcaputo Feb 10, 2011
Commits on Feb 20, 2011
  1. Modified Wheel::Run to accept winsize argument again, using Termios T…

    shabble committed with rcaputo Feb 20, 2011
    …IOCSWINSZ
    
    ioctl.
    
    Probably not portable from *nix, but it's a start.
Commits on Feb 16, 2011
  1. Add process IDs to _warn(), _die(), etc.

    rcaputo committed Feb 16, 2011
    Remove $SIG{__WARN_} and $SIG{__DIE__} handlers---they seem to be support for pre-5.6 Perl.
Commits on Feb 11, 2011
  1. Standardize non-blocking on IO::Handle's blocking(0) call. This may c…

    rcaputo committed Feb 11, 2011
    …ause problems for systems using Perl older than 5.8.1.
Commits on Feb 9, 2011
  1. Remove POE::Resource::Statistics. Move POE::Resource::FileHandles, PO…

    rcaputo committed Feb 8, 2011
    …E::Resource::Sessions and POE::Resource::Signals data structures from session references to session IDs.
Commits on Feb 8, 2011
Commits on Feb 7, 2011
  1. Add a sequence number to POE::Kernel's ID.

    rcaputo committed Feb 7, 2011
    Kernels need unique IDs each time they're started, even within the
    same process.  Kernels need unique IDs in each thread.
Commits on Feb 4, 2011
Commits on Feb 3, 2011
  1. Bump version for release.

    rcaputo committed Feb 3, 2011
Commits on Jan 29, 2011
  1. Bump dependency.

    rcaputo committed Jan 29, 2011
Commits on Jan 27, 2011
  1. Resolve a test failure on CentOS, which appears to be a race conditio…

    Perl Whore committed with rcaputo Jan 27, 2011
    …n in the test itself. Resolves rt.cpan.org #61727.
  2. Fix Apocalypse's MSWin32 TODO for non-Windows machines. Unless I've s…

    rcaputo committed Jan 27, 2011
    …ecretly broken it. :)
  3. Work around the possibility that Socket::GetAddrInfo isn't loaded whe…

    rcaputo committed Jan 27, 2011
    …n someone needs IPv6. Reported by Apocalypse in irc.perl.org.
  4. Tweak the PWR exitval test for MSWin32, turning it into a TODO so we …

    apocalypse committed Jan 27, 2011
    …can study what the heck happens
  5. Resolve a race condition that caused the last line of rapid input to …

    dmw397 committed with rcaputo Jan 27, 2011
    …be delayed. Resolves rt.cpan.org ticket #63242.
  6. delete $ENV{POE_ASSERT_USAGE} so that 11_assert_usage.t and 13_assert…

    Philip Gwyn committed Jan 27, 2011
    …_data.t
    
    can do their thing.